What does this mean for riders?
The Dualtron Rovoron R7 Pro includes dual motors. Among 344 comparable scooters, 39% share this feature — a relatively uncommon extra.
Dualtron Rovoron R7 Pro comes equipped with dual motors. In today’s high-end scooter market, having two motors is quite common among models aimed at riders who want extra thrust and traction. With both motors engaged, the R7 Pro delivers a more even power delivery, meaning acceleration feels smooth and controlled rather than jerky.
In practice, dual motors enable the scooter to tackle steeper inclines and maintain momentum under heavier loads more confidently than a single-motor setup. You’ll notice quicker takeoffs at traffic lights or when you need to surge past an obstacle. On the flip side, running two motors can add to overall weight and mechanical complexity, and under aggressive riding it may draw more battery power than a single-motor alternative.
This feature especially matters for performance-oriented riders, those who frequently encounter hilly routes or off-road sections, and heavier riders who need that extra push. If your typical ride is a flat, short commute or you’re focused solely on maximizing range with minimal weight, dual motors might not be as essential—but for anyone craving solid acceleration and confidence on varied terrain, “yes” to dual motors is a clear plus.

Frequently Asked Questions — Dualtron Rovoron R7 Pro
A dual motor electric scooter features two separate drive units (usually one on each wheel) which work together to deliver higher torque and acceleration than a single-motor setup. This configuration improves hill climbing, off-road traction, and load capacity but typically adds weight and increases energy consumption.
If your commute involves steep hills, frequent stops, or carrying heavy loads, a dual motor scooter can offer smoother acceleration and better grip. For flat, short-distance urban commutes under 10 miles, a single motor scooter may suffice, offering lighter weight, lower cost, and longer range.
Dual motor scooters require similar routine care as single-motor units—regular tire and brake checks, hardware torque inspections, and battery management. However, they also need periodic motor calibration or belt tensioning for both drive units. Expect marginally higher upkeep time and costs due to two motors, especially in wet or high-dust environments.
